excel怎么排名次顺序(Excel排名方法)
作者:路由通
|

发布时间:2025-06-09 05:52:33
标签:
Excel排名次顺序全方位深度解析 在数据处理与分析领域,Excel的排序功能是基础但至关重要的操作。准确掌握排名次顺序的方法不仅能提升工作效率,还能确保数据呈现的逻辑性和可读性。无论是学生成绩统计、销售业绩评估,还是项目管理中的任务优先

<>
Excel排名次顺序全方位深度解析
在数据处理与分析领域,Excel的排序功能是基础但至关重要的操作。准确掌握排名次顺序的方法不仅能提升工作效率,还能确保数据呈现的逻辑性和可读性。无论是学生成绩统计、销售业绩评估,还是项目管理中的任务优先级划分,合理的排序机制都能帮助用户快速定位关键信息。本文将系统性地剖析Excel中实现排名次顺序的八种核心方法,涵盖基础操作、函数应用、条件格式等高级技巧,并通过多维度对比表格展示不同场景下的最优解决方案。值得注意的是,每种方法都有其适用场景和局限性,理解这些差异对实际应用至关重要。
进阶技巧包括使用"排序提醒"功能防止数据错位,以及通过"扩展选定区域"选项保持数据关联性。当处理超过1万行数据时,建议先创建表格对象(Ctrl+T)再执行排序,可显著提升操作稳定性。
实际应用时需注意绝对引用区域($符号),否则填充公式会导致引用范围变化。对于大型数据集,建议将排名结果输出到辅助列,而非直接在原数据列操作,以避免循环引用。
高级应用中可结合公式自定义条件格式规则,例如突出显示前10%的数据。注意条件格式的优先级管理,当多个规则冲突时,后创建的规则会覆盖先前的设置。
对于超大数据集(超过100万行),建议在Power Pivot中创建数据模型后再进行透视分析,可显著提升运算性能。同时可利用切片器实现多维度动态筛选,增强报表交互性。
实际应用时需要注意SUBTOTAL函数的嵌套限制,在Excel 2019及以后版本中最多支持64层嵌套。对于复杂的分级排名需求,建议结合AGGREGATE函数使用,可提供更灵活的参数选项。
进阶技巧包括使用M语言编写自定义排序函数,以及利用"缓冲区"操作提升大文件处理速度。注意Power Query的排序操作是持久化的,每次刷新查询都会重新执行排序过程。
专业级开发建议包括:添加错误处理机制(On Error语句)、优化循环结构减少资源占用、为关键操作添加进度条显示。注意启用宏的工作簿需要另存为.xlsm格式。
使用动态数组时需注意"SPILL!"错误的处理,确保目标区域有足够空白单元格。与传统函数相比,动态数组公式更节省内存,但对低版本Excel的兼容性有限。
>
Excel排名次顺序全方位深度解析
在数据处理与分析领域,Excel的排序功能是基础但至关重要的操作。准确掌握排名次顺序的方法不仅能提升工作效率,还能确保数据呈现的逻辑性和可读性。无论是学生成绩统计、销售业绩评估,还是项目管理中的任务优先级划分,合理的排序机制都能帮助用户快速定位关键信息。本文将系统性地剖析Excel中实现排名次顺序的八种核心方法,涵盖基础操作、函数应用、条件格式等高级技巧,并通过多维度对比表格展示不同场景下的最优解决方案。值得注意的是,每种方法都有其适用场景和局限性,理解这些差异对实际应用至关重要。
一、基础升序/降序排列功能
Excel内置的排序功能是最直接的排名次顺序解决方案。通过选中数据区域后点击"数据"选项卡中的"升序"或"降序"按钮,可快速完成简单排序。此方法适用于单列数值型数据的快速处理,但对多条件排序支持有限。操作步骤分解:- 选中需要排序的数据列(建议包含标题行)
- 在"数据"选项卡点击排序按钮
- 选择排序依据(数值、单元格颜色等)
- 设置排序方向(A到Z或Z到A)
功能 | 优点 | 缺点 | 适用场景 |
---|---|---|---|
基础排序 | 操作简单直观 | 无法处理并列排名 | 简单数据列表 |
多列排序 | 支持主次条件 | 需手动设置顺序 | 复杂数据分类 |
自定义排序 | 可按特定序列 | 需预先定义列表 | 非标准排序需求 |
二、RANK函数家族应用
Excel提供三类排名函数处理不同需求:RANK.EQ(传统排名)、RANK.AVG(平均排名)和RANK(兼容函数)。这些函数能自动计算数值在数据集中的相对位置,特别适合需要保留原始数据顺序的场景。函数类型 | 并列处理方式 | 语法示例 | 结果差异 |
---|---|---|---|
RANK.EQ | 相同数值同排名,跳过后续位次 | =RANK.EQ(A2,$A$2:$A$100) | 1,2,2,4 |
RANK.AVG | 相同数值取平均排名 | =RANK.AVG(A2,$A$2:$A$100) | 1,2.5,2.5,4 |
RANK | 兼容旧版本 | =RANK(A2,$A$2:$A$100) | 同RANK.EQ |
三、条件格式可视化排序
通过条件格式实现排名次顺序的可视化呈现,能在不改变数据实际位置的情况下直观显示数值大小关系。常用方法包括数据条、色阶和图标集三种形式。操作流程示例(以数据条为例):- 选中目标数据区域
- 点击"开始"→"条件格式"→"数据条"
- 选择渐变或实心填充样式
- 设置最小值/最大值类型(自动/数字/百分比等)
可视化类型 | 适用数据类型 | 优势 | 局限性 |
---|---|---|---|
数据条 | 连续数值 | 直观对比大小 | 负值显示异常 |
色阶 | 范围分布 | 显示趋势变化 | 色盲识别困难 |
图标集 | 离散等级 | 快速分类 | 阈值设置复杂 |
四、数据透视表动态排名
数据透视表提供强大的交互式排名功能,特别适合需要频繁变更分析维度的场景。通过值字段设置可实现多种排序方式,且结果随源数据更新自动调整。创建带排名的数据透视表步骤:- 插入数据透视表并拖放字段到行/值区域
- 右键点击值字段→"值显示方式"→"降序排列"
- 在"字段设置"中选择"显示为排名"选项
- 使用筛选器控制显示项目数量
排序方式 | 计算逻辑 | 刷新机制 | 内存占用 |
---|---|---|---|
手动排序 | 固定顺序 | 需手动更新 | 低 |
自动排序 | 按值大小 | 实时响应 | 中 |
自定义排序 | 指定序列 | 依赖缓存 | 高 |
五、SUBTOTAL函数分级排名
SUBTOTAL函数是处理分类排名的理想工具,其独特功能在于可忽略被筛选掉的隐藏行进行计算。配合筛选功能使用,可实现动态分组的局部排名效果。典型应用公式结构:- =SUBTOTAL(104,$B$2:$B$100)-SUBTOTAL(103,$B$2:$B$100)+1
- 其中104表示计数非空单元格,103表示忽略隐藏行的计数
函数编号 | 功能描述 | 是否忽略隐藏行 | 典型应用 |
---|---|---|---|
101-111 | 基本统计函数 | 是 | 筛选后计算 |
1-11 | 同类函数 | 否 | 常规计算 |
六、Power Query高级排序技术
Power Query作为Excel的数据预处理工具,提供比原生功能更强大的排名次顺序能力。其优势在于可处理复杂条件排序,并建立可重复使用的数据处理流程。典型操作流程:- 数据→获取数据→启动Power Query编辑器
- 选择需排序的列→"排序"按钮
- 添加多级排序条件
- 创建自定义排序列(通过"添加列"→"索引列")
排序类型 | 处理能力 | 执行效率 | 适用数据量 |
---|---|---|---|
基本排序 | 单/多列 | 高 | ≤100万行 |
自定义排序 | 复杂规则 | 中 | ≤50万行 |
条件排序 | 公式驱动 | 低 | ≤10万行 |
七、VBA宏自动化排序方案
对于需要定期执行的复杂排名任务,VBA宏可提供完全自动化的解决方案。通过编写脚本可实现自定义排序算法、异常值处理等高级功能。基础VBA排序代码框架:- Sub CustomSort()
- Range("A1:D100").Sort Key1:=Range("B2"), Order1:=xlDescending
- End Sub
VBA方法 | 功能描述 | 执行速度 | 开发难度 |
---|---|---|---|
Range.Sort | 基础排序 | 快 | 低 |
数组排序 | 内存计算 | 极快 | 中 |
API调用 | 系统级排序 | 不稳定 | 高 |
八、动态数组函数新时代排序
Excel 365引入的动态数组函数彻底改变了传统排名次顺序的实现方式。SORT、SORTBY等函数可输出自动扩展的结果区域,大幅简化复杂排序公式的编写。典型公式示例:- =SORT(A2:C100,2,-1) //按第二列降序
- =SORTBY(A2:A100,B2:B100,-1,C2:C100,1) //多列排序
- =FILTER(SORT(...),...) //排序后筛选
函数名称 | 核心功能 | 溢出特性 | 版本要求 |
---|---|---|---|
SORT | 基础排序 | 支持 | Excel 365 |
SORTBY | 按参照列排序 | 支持 | Excel 2021 |
UNIQUE+SORT | 去重排序 | 组合实现 | Excel 2019 |

掌握Excel中的排名次顺序技术需要理解不同方法的适用场景和底层逻辑。从基础操作到高级函数,每种方案都有其独特的价值。实际工作中往往需要组合多种技术,例如先用Power Query清洗数据,再通过数据透视表展示动态排名,最后用条件格式增强可视化效果。随着Excel功能的持续更新,新的排序方法不断涌现,但核心原则始终不变:准确反映数据关系,清晰传达业务洞察。值得注意的是,任何排序操作前都应备份原始数据,避免不可逆的操作失误。对于特别重要的排序任务,建议分阶段验证结果,确保每个处理环节都符合预期。
>
相关文章
电脑版微信语音功能深度攻略 在移动办公和跨设备沟通成为常态的今天,电脑版微信的语音功能已成为职场人士和学生群体的核心需求。相比手机端,电脑版微信的语音操作存在明显的功能差异和使用门槛:从基础的通话机制到高级的会议应用,从硬件兼容性到隐私保
2025-06-09 05:52:25

多平台双微信下载与使用深度攻略 在移动互联网时代,微信已成为国民级社交应用,但单一账号难以满足工作生活分离的需求。本文将从系统兼容性、账号管理、数据隔离等八个维度,全面解析如何在不同设备上实现双微信共存。通过对比官方与非官方方案的优劣,提
2025-06-09 05:52:27

在Windows 10系统下使用专为Windows 8设计的软件,本质上是跨版本兼容的技术实践。由于Windows 10与Windows 8共享相同的NT内核架构,理论上多数Win8软件可直接运行,但实际应用中会面临API调用差异、系统权限
2025-06-09 05:52:22

Word文档图片统一调整大小全面攻略 在办公场景中,Word文档的图片排版直接影响专业性和阅读体验。统一调整图片大小不仅能提升视觉一致性,还能优化文档体积和打印效果。然而,由于Word功能复杂性和多平台差异,用户常面临格式错乱、比例失真等
2025-06-09 05:52:00

财务系统Excel实战指南 在企业数字化转型的背景下,Excel作为财务管理的经典工具,其灵活性和可定制性仍然不可替代。构建高效的财务系统需要兼顾数据采集、流程规范、分析维度和跨平台协作等核心要素。本文将基于实际业务场景,从八个维度深入解
2025-06-09 05:51:54

抖音多视频合拍深度攻略 在抖音平台,合拍功能已成为用户互动创作的重要方式。通过与其他用户或官方内容联动,创作者能快速提升作品曝光度并强化社交属性。多视频合拍不仅涉及技术操作,更需考虑内容匹配度、流量算法适配及创意融合等维度。本攻略将从设备
2025-06-09 05:51:53

热门推荐
资讯中心: